Sour Cream Chicken Paprika

Servings

5

Ingredients

  • 4 skinless, boneless chicken breast halves
  • 1 1/2 tablespoons butter
  • 1 1/2 tablespoons vegetable oil
  • 1 cup chopped onion
  • 2 tablespoons papri
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 2 cups chicken stock
  • 1 (8 ounce) container sour cream
  • 1 teaspoon plain flour

Instructions

  1. You can leave breasts whole or cut them up, whatever your preference. In a large skillet, fry chicken in oil until cooked through and juices run clear. Remove chicken from skillet and set aside.
  2. Add butter or margarine and onion to skillet. Sauté onion until translucent, not brown. Add paprika and salt and stir. Then add stock and bring all to a boil. While stock is coming to a boil, stir flour into sour cream and mix well. When stock has come to a boil, reduce heat to simmer and add the sour cream mixture (to smooth sour cream lumps, use a whisk). Add reserved chicken to skillet and simmer in sauce until chicken heated through and sauce has thickened.
